Understanding Lean Methodology
Lean methodology centers around the idea of continuous improvement and efficiency. It encourages startups to identify and eliminate non-value-added activities in their processes. The goal is to create streamlined operations that focus on delivering products or services that meet customer needs without superfluous expenses.
- Value Identification: Start by understanding what your customers genuinely value.
- Map Value Stream: Analyze the steps required to deliver value and identify waste.
- Create Flow: Ensure that work processes are smooth and uninterrupted.
- Establish Pull: Produce only what is needed based on customer demand.
- Seek Perfection: Continuously iterate and improve.
Implementing Lean in Startups
Applying lean principles in a startup involves various strategic choices. Begin with small, manageable changes and progressively integrate lean practices into broader operations. Here are some practical steps:
Focus on Minimum Viable Product (MVP)
An MVP allows startups to test hypotheses with minimal resources. By prioritizing essential features, you gather customer feedback and iterate without extensive upfront investment.
Build a Lean Culture
Embed lean principles into your startup culture. Encourage team members to think lean by fostering an environment where continuous improvement is valued. Regularly host brainstorming sessions to identify inefficiencies and propose solutions.
